INJ OPENS A NEW ROUTE INTO SOLANA — WHERE WILL LIQUIDITY GO?
Injective has launched INJ on Solana through Sunrise, with Raydium and StonkFun as its first partners. The initial INJ liquidity pool is now live on Raydium, while StonkFun supports INJ as a base pair asset and allows creators to issue tokens paired with INJ, including markets linked to tokenized stocks.
